What is ValueSort?
ValueSort is a free browser extension that helps you find the best value items when shopping online. It reads the price per unit information shown on supported supermarket sites and reorders the products so that the cheapest per unit is shown at the top.
Which supermarkets does ValueSort support?
ValueSort currently supports Tesco, Morrisons, and Asda.
Does ValueSort take Clubcard prices and special offers into account?
Yes. ValueSort checks for multibuy deals like “3 for £1” or “4 for the price of 3” and uses those prices when reordering products
Is ValueSort free?
Yes. ValueSort is completely free to use. There’s also an optional way to donate if you’d like to support future development.
Does ValueSort collect my data?
ValueSort only reads product data on the page in order to calculate and apply sorting. It does not track you across sites, create a profile, or upload your browsing data to any server.

How can I start using ValueSort?
To start using ValueSort:
- Install the extension:
- Toggle the extension to be on
- Open a supported supermarket website and search for an item
- Wait until the page loads — ValueSort will automatically run and reorder the products.
You can then browse as normal, knowing the best value options are shown first.
